PGA400-Q1 - Pressure-Sensor Signal Conditioner

General Description

The PGA400-Q1 is an interface device for piezoresistive, strain gauge, and capacitive-sense elements.

The device incorporates the analog front end (AFE) that directly connects to the sense element and has voltage regulators and an oscillator.
